B1 parking lot near Hesburgh Center to close June 1

Author: Cidni Sanders

Beginning Monday, June 1, the B1 parking lot at Notre Dame Avenue and Holy Cross Drive (south of the Hesburgh Center for International Studies) will become a construction site for the future Jenkins Hall and Nanovic Hall.

Faculty and staff who use this lot will have two nearby alternative options for parking during the workday:

  • The BK-1 lot along Holy Cross Drive between the Hammes Notre Dame Bookstore and Cedar Grove Cemetery will have open parking for anyone, including faculty and staff.

  • The visitor lot at Holy Cross Drive and Eddy Street across from the DeBartolo Performing Arts Center will become a gated lot for faculty and staff during normal business hours.

Pedestrians will still have use of walkways surrounding the project site, including several that meet Americans with Disabilities Act accessibility guidelines, for easy access to buildings in the area.
